  • Inkscape for Beginners - Lesson 1.5! Let's create some shapes!
    This will show you how to make a rectangle, square, circle, and oval. Change them into nodes to create a basic flower that you can cut on Cricut. This will be the first in a series of Inkscape for Beginners.
